New vs surplus in Cambridge

New clay tiles through Cambridge merchants typically costs 40–70% more than surplus equivalents at similar spec. Reclaimed heritage grades can command a premium over new when planning specifies matching stock.

+How many clay tiles per m²?

Plain: 60/m². Pantiles: 16/m². Peg: 55–65/m².
